l'm looking for a little history info for this earlier 1980's OZ chassis. It came from the Argos, Indiana area.Not much is known about it. Perhaps someone may recognize it...you can see someone added a second set of wing mounts. There is also added bracing to the steering bar that goes across the roll cage.It appears to me it has had a new front clip at some point and minor repair to the rear radius rod mount area on both sides. The top and bottom frame rails on both sides directly in front of motor plate area have 2 welds around them giving the clip replacement hint. Very nice job though. I would say it went back to the original shop for the repairs.It appears that its last ride knocked off the right front shock bracket.The only clue ever mentioned was a possible Hank Lower car but nothing at this point can be proven.Overall its in nice shape.Its a long shot, but i'm hoping someone may recognize it and I can retrace its owners and history. Any help, leads or ideas appreciated. thanks, rc

  #7 12/4/16 3:25 PM
Cris Eash 17E
Darren Eash 7
Jim Nace 26
Fred Linder 3x
Robbie Stanley 44R
Rodney Duncan 22
Tim Norman 5J
Kerry Norris 5N
Joe Gaerte 3G
Eric Gordon 75
Jeff Gordon 16
Joey Saldana 88 (white car/blue numbers)
I believe these cars were all Oz cars.
